Getting an electronic key
Key chips are embedded microchip inside your car key that transmits radio signals at a low level. This signals the immobilizer to release and allows you to start the car. The chips also have an electronic serial number that authenticates the key and prevents auto theft. You can obtain an exchange for your lost key by calling locksmith. Getting an locksmith
A locksmith can reprogram a key fob, or car key that has stopped functioning if you've lost it. This is a simple and secure method to get back on the road. You may also ask locksmiths for assistance in other things like making a brand new key or removing damaged key. Some locksmiths offer a mobile key programming near me service that makes it easier to receive the assistance you require.
Transponder technology is employed in a number of vehicles to stop theft. This means that they have to be programmed in order to be compatible with the anti-theft systems of your vehicle. A car locksmith or a mechanic can do this. This is a cost-intensive process that requires specialized equipment as well as an application. DIY is a way to save money, but it's a risk and could harm the system.
Think about hiring an experienced auto locksmith to re-program your keys. They have the experience and tools needed to complete this task safely and safely. Additionally, they can save you lots of time and anxiety by doing it correctly the first time.
They can program your new key quickly and often at a lower cost. They have the tools to connect to the onboard computer of your car, which allows them to enter programming mode. This is a faster and safer method of programming keys than waiting in the dealership.
Some vehicles have an onboard computer with locks that limit the number of times a locksmith can program it. These systems are operated by a token system. This means that each programming session must be paid for using a pre-paid token. This cost is included in the cost of the programming service.
You will learn the exact steps to program a keyless entry remote in the owner's manual or online. The majority of these procedures require the car is open and the onboard diagnostics port is accessible. This is to read the correct crucial data from the module.
